Patch Diff

ghidriff (VersionTrackingDiff, PDB symbols) · afd.sys (KB5041585)

Use-after-free in the Registered I/O (RIO) buffer cache (CVE-2024-38193, exploited ITW by Lazarus Group). Race condition between AfdRioGetAndCacheBuffer (_InterlockedIncrement on RIOBuffer.RefCount during cache fill) and AfdRioDereferenceBuffer (non-atomic RefCount==1 check + ExFreePool). Patch: AfdRioDereferenceBuffer uses atomic decrement with underflow bugcheck, AfdRioGetAndCacheBuffer calls new AfdRioReferenceBuffer for safe acquire, RIOBuffer.RefCount widened to 64-bit. All gated by CFR Feature_3168083257 + Feature_3695514937.

Pre-patch version 10.0.22621.3672 Download
Post-patch version 10.0.22621.4036 Download
Function Address Change Note
AfdRioDereferenceBuffer code (ratio 0.48, significant rewrite) Non-atomic RefCount==1 check replaced with atomic decrement + underflow guard (swi(0x29) bugcheck). RefCount widened to 64-bit. Gated by Feature_3168083257 / Feature_3695514937 (Feature_AfdRioCachedBuffer_IsEnabled).
AfdRioGetAndCacheBuffer code (ratio 0.48, significant rewrite) Raw _InterlockedIncrement(&RefCount) replaced with call to new AfdRioReferenceBuffer — returns NULL if buffer already freed, eliminating the TOCTOU window.
AfdRioReferenceBuffer (added) added function New atomic reference-acquire: checks IsInvalid and atomically increments RefCount only if buffer is still alive, returns 0 on failure.
AfdRioGetCachedBuffer code Cache hit/miss dispatcher, calls AfdRioGetAndCacheBuffer on miss.
AfdRioEvictCachedBuffer code (ratio 0.70) Cache eviction path updated to match new RIOBuffer layout.
AfdRioCreateRegisteredBuffer code (ratio 0.95) RIOBuffer allocation updated for wider structure (IsInvalid +0x18→+0x24, RefCount 32→64-bit at +0x18).
AfdRioInvalidateBuffer code (ratio 0.96) IsInvalid field access updated for new offset.

Attack Path

Use-after-free in the AFD Registered I/O buffer cache - a non-atomic refcount check races the cache-fill increment. Exploited in the wild by Lazarus Group.

Attack path for CVE-2024-38193 Use-after-free in the AFD Registered I/O buffer cache - a non-atomic refcount check races the cache-fill increment. Exploited in the wild by Lazarus Group. Attacker thread A RIO buffer cache RIOBuffer (0x20, 'RIOb') Attacker thread B RIORegisterBuffer(buf, len) - AfdRioCreateRegisteredBuffer 1 Acquires the write spinlock, finds a free slot in ArrayBuffers[], ExAllocatePool2(NonPaged, 0x20, 'RIOb'), sets RIOBuffer.RefCount = 1, releases the lock. Any unprivileged user; Winsock RIO needs no special rights. Thread A: RIOSend/RIOReceive -> AfdRioGetAndCacheBuffer(id) on cache miss 2 [A] v5 = ArrayBuffers[id] [B] if (!v5 || v5->IsInvalid) return NULL 3 The pointer is read and the validity flag checked, but nothing holds a reference yet. Thread B: AfdRioDereferenceBuffer sees RefCount == 1 and calls ExFreePool 4 The pre-patch check is a plain read-compare, not an atomic decrement. It can observe 1 in the window between Thread A's [B] and [C] and free the buffer out from under it. [C] _InterlockedIncrement(&v5->RefCount) on the freed block 5 Thread A increments a refcount inside pool memory that Thread B has already returned. The buffer then stays in CachedBufferArrays[] and is used for subsequent send/receive. Freed 0x20-byte NonPaged 'RIOb' block used as a live buffer descriptor 6 Patch: AfdRioDereferenceBuffer uses an atomic decrement with an underflow bugcheck, AfdRioGetAndCacheBuffer acquires via the new AfdRioReferenceBuffer, and RefCount widens to 64-bit. Gated behind Feature_3168083257 and Feature_3695514937.
